What I find insane about some high level chef recipes is the amount of ingredients you need for a buff that wears out in two minutes. Look at Elshandruu Pica Thundercloud for example (Mix 4). You need 4 identical alcohols. Lets say you want to make the best Thundercloud possible, so you make 4 Aludian pu36's (40 ingredients each. So you have 40+40+40+40+30 radioactive+30 neutronium steel+30 fruit. This drink requires 210 ingredientsand lasts 150 seconds lol....
